
An Austrian masterpiece with great aging potential.
Aged 20 months in 500L oak barrels
This is first Blaufränkisch in our portfolio and there's a reason. It's certainly not a very well known grape in the US, and that's a shame because it's delicious, particularly if you're pairing with traditional German or Austrian fare. The one really captivates with concentrated aromas of dark berries, subtle spice, and a hint of minerality. On the palate, it shows an impressive structure, fine-grained tannins, and a long, complex finish. A fantastic example of just how good this varietal can be.
Dark ruby garnet, purple reflections, delicate edge brightening. Ripe black berry fruit, nuances of blackberries and cherries, a hint of herbal savouriness and orange zest, background of fine nougat. Juicy, elegant, fine fruity sweetness, silky tannins, mineral and long-lasting, certain ageing potential, already easy to drink.
Youthful color, intense, complex nose, cranberry, lingonberry, sloe berries, cedar notes, juniper, full-bodied, dense and elegant on the palate, fine-grained tannins, long-lasting finish, with cornel cherry in the aftertaste.
